Britain’s Department for Business and Trade has expressed concerns that the rules of origin deal with Canada may not be extended, potentially impacting trade arrangements and tariffs for carmakers in the UK. Talks between the two countries paused in January, and with the agreement set to expire, facing uncertainties loom. The UK has attributed the pause to disagreements with Canada over rules of origin and access to agricultural markets, putting trade at risk. While the UK remains open to finding a solution, the possibility of increased costs and tariffs on auto exports to Canada could have significant implications for businesses on both sides of the Atlantic.
